DARLING, Robert Eugene 'Bob'
Robert 'Bob' Eugene Darling of Gold River, California, died on September 3, 2013 at the age of 84 from complications of kidney disease. Bob was born on December 22, 1928, to parents LeRoy and Regina Darling. He and his brother Bradford were born and raised in Newton, Kansas. Bob attended Kansas State University where he earned a Bachelor of Science Degree in Industrial Engineering and was Chapter President of Sigma Alpha Epsilon fraternity. He later went on to become a Sloan Fellow and earn a Master of Science Degree in Management at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ology. In 1954, while Bob was serving with the U.S. Air Force in Chaumont, France, the love of his life, Beverly Faith Janzen, of McPherson, Kansas traveled to Europe so that they could marry. Bob went on to have a successful civilian career with the Department of Defense, working for the Air Force for 33 years where he was a charter member of the Senior Executive Service. He also continued to serve in the U. S. Air Force Reserve until retiring as a Colonel in 1988. Throughout his career and their lives together, he and Bev called many places home, but they always loved Sacramento and eventually retired there. Bob had a lifelong commitment to community service including as President of local chapters of the United Way and Rotary International. He loved nothing more than to spend time with his family. His other passions included Kansas State football, great food, travel, and fishing. Preceding him in death were his wife, Beverly, and his brother Bradford. Bob is survived by sons Steven Bradford (Patricia DeLoatche) of Gold River, California; Corbin Patrick (Lisa), of Golden, Colorado; Trenton Michael (Kristin) of Colorado Springs, Colorado; and David Tyler (Michi Toki) of San Francisco, California. Bob had 5 grandchildren, of whom he was very proud: Clare, Jackson, Tesslyn, Koji and Sheadyn.
